Atherton has many large substantial homes - our clients purchased an existing home on a one acre flag-shaped lot and asked us to design a new dream home for them. The result is a new 7,000 square foot four-building complex consisting of the main house, six-car garage with two car lifts, pool house with a full one bedroom residence inside, and a separate home office /work out gym studio building. A fifty-foot swimming pool was also created with fully landscaped yards.
Given the rectangular shape of the lot, it was decided to angle the house to incoming visitors slightly so as to more dramatically present itself. The house became a classic u-shaped home but Feng Shui design principals were employed directing the placement of the pool house to better contain the energy flow on the site. The main house entry door is then aligned with a special Japanese red maple at the end of a long visual axis at the rear of the site. These angles and alignments set up everything else about the house design and layout, and views from various rooms allow you to see into virtually every space tracking movements of others in the home.
The residence is simply divided into two wings of public use, kitchen and family room, and the other wing of bedrooms, connected by the living and dining great room. Function drove the exterior form of windows and solid walls with a line of clerestory windows which bring light into the middle of the large home. Extensive sun shadow studies with 3D tree modeling led to the unorthodox placement of the pool to the north of the home, but tree shadow tracking showed this to be the sunniest area during the entire year.
Sustainable measures included a full 7.1kW solar photovoltaic array technically making the house off the grid, and arranged so that no panels are visible from the property. A large 16,000 gallon rainwater catchment system consisting of tanks buried below grade was installed. The home is California GreenPoint rated and also features sealed roof soffits and a sealed crawlspace without the usual venting. A whole house computer automation system with server room was installed as well. Heating and cooling utilize hot water radiant heated concrete and wood floors supplemented by heat pump generated heating and cooling.
A compound of buildings created to form balanced relationships between each other, this home is about circulation, light and a balance of form and function.

7RR-Ecohome:
The design objective was to build a house for a couple recently married who both had kids from previous marriages. How to bridge two families together?
The design looks forward in terms of how people live today. The home is an experiment in transparency and solid form; removing borders and edges from outside to inside the house, and to really depict “flowing and endless space”. The house floor plan is derived by pushing and pulling the house’s form to maximize the backyard and minimize the public front yard while welcoming the sun in key rooms by rotating the house 45-degrees to true north. The angular form of the house is a result of the family’s program, the zoning rules, the lot’s attributes, and the sun’s path. We wanted to construct a house that is smart and efficient in terms of construction and energy, both in terms of the building and the user. We could tell a story of how the house is built in terms of the constructability, structure and enclosure, with a nod to Japanese wood construction in the method in which the siding is installed and the exposed interior beams are placed in the double height space. We engineered the house to be smart which not only looks modern but acts modern; every aspect of user control is simplified to a digital touch button, whether lights, shades, blinds, HVAC, communication, audio, video, or security. We developed a planning module based on a 6-foot square room size and a 6-foot wide connector called an interstitial space for hallways, bathrooms, stairs and mechanical, which keeps the rooms pure and uncluttered. The house is 6,200 SF of livable space, plus garage and basement gallery for a total of 9,200 SF. A large formal foyer celebrates the entry and opens up to the living, dining, kitchen and family rooms all focused on the rear garden. The east side of the second floor is the Master wing and a center bridge connects it to the kid’s wing on the west. Second floor terraces and sunscreens provide views and shade in this suburban setting. The playful mathematical grid of the house in the x, y and z axis also extends into the layout of the trees and hard-scapes, all centered on a suburban one-acre lot.
Many green attributes were designed into the home; Ipe wood sunscreens and window shades block out unwanted solar gain in summer, but allow winter sun in. Patio door and operable windows provide ample opportunity for natural ventilation throughout the open floor plan. Minimal windows on east and west sides to reduce heat loss in winter and unwanted gains in summer. Open floor plan and large window expanse reduces lighting demands and maximizes available daylight. Skylights provide natural light to the basement rooms. Durable, low-maintenance exterior materials include stone, ipe wood siding and decking, and concrete roof pavers. Design is based on a 2' planning grid to minimize construction waste. Basement foundation walls and slab are highly insulated. FSC-certified walnut wood flooring was used. Light colored concrete roof pavers to reduce cooling loads by as much as 15%. 2x6 framing allows for more insulation and energy savings. Super efficient windows have low-E argon gas filled units, and thermally insulated aluminum frames. Permeable brick and stone pavers reduce the site’s storm-water runoff. Countertops use recycled composite materials. Energy-Star rated furnaces and smart thermostats are located throughout the house to minimize duct runs and avoid energy loss. Energy-Star rated boiler that heats up both radiant floors and domestic hot water. Low-flow toilets and plumbing fixtures are used to conserve water usage. No VOC finish options and direct venting fireplaces maintain a high interior air quality. Smart home system controls lighting, HVAC, and shades to better manage energy use. Plumbing runs through interior walls reducing possibilities of heat loss and freezing problems. A large food pantry was placed next to kitchen to reduce trips to the grocery store. Home office reduces need for automobile transit and associated CO2 footprint. Plan allows for aging in place, with guest suite than can become the master suite, with no need to move as family members mature.

2101 Connecticut Avenue (c.1928), an 8-story brick and limestone Beaux Arts style building with spacious apartments, is said to have been “the finest apartment house to appear in Washington between the two World Wars.” (James M. Goode, Best Addresses, 1988.) As advertised for rent in 1928, the apartments were designed “to incorporate many details that would aid the residents in establishing a home atmosphere, one possessing charm and dignity usually found only in a private house… the character and tenancy (being) assured through careful selection of guests.” Home to Senators, Ambassadors, a Vice President and a Supreme Court Justice as well as numerous Washington socialites, the building still stands as one of the undisputed “best addresses” in Washington, DC.)
So well laid-out was this gracious 3,000 sf apartment that the basic floor plan remains unchanged from the original architect’s 1927 design. The organizing feature was, and continues to be, the grand “gallery” space in the center of the unit. Every room in the apartment can be accessed via the gallery, thus preserving it as the centerpiece of the “charm and dignity” which the original design intended. Programmatic modifications consisted of the addition of a small powder room off of the foyer, and the conversion of a corner “sun room” into a room for meditation and study. The apartment received a thorough updating of all systems, services and finishes, including a new kitchen and new bathrooms, several new built-in cabinetry units, and the consolidation of numerous small closets and passageways into more accessible and efficient storage spaces.

Klopf Architecture and Outer space Landscape Architects designed a new warm, modern, open, indoor-outdoor home in Los Altos, California. Inspired by mid-century modern homes but looking for something completely new and custom, the owners, a couple with two children, bought an older ranch style home with the intention of replacing it.
Created on a grid, the house is designed to be at rest with differentiated spaces for activities; living, playing, cooking, dining and a piano space. The low-sloping gable roof over the great room brings a grand feeling to the space. The clerestory windows at the high sloping roof make the grand space light and airy.
Upon entering the house, an open atrium entry in the middle of the house provides light and nature to the great room. The Heath tile wall at the back of the atrium blocks direct view of the rear yard from the entry door for privacy.
The bedrooms, bathrooms, play room and the sitting room are under flat wing-like roofs that balance on either side of the low sloping gable roof of the main space. Large sliding glass panels and pocketing glass doors foster openness to the front and back yards. In the front there is a fenced-in play space connected to the play room, creating an indoor-outdoor play space that could change in use over the years. The play room can also be closed off from the great room with a large pocketing door. In the rear, everything opens up to a deck overlooking a pool where the family can come together outdoors.
Wood siding travels from exterior to interior, accentuating the indoor-outdoor nature of the house. Where the exterior siding doesn’t come inside, a palette of white oak floors, white walls, walnut cabinetry, and dark window frames ties all the spaces together to create a uniform feeling and flow throughout the house. The custom cabinetry matches the minimal joinery of the rest of the house, a trim-less, minimal appearance. Wood siding was mitered in the corners, including where siding meets the interior drywall. Wall materials were held up off the floor with a minimal reveal. This tight detailing gives a sense of cleanliness to the house.
The garage door of the house is completely flush and of the same material as the garage wall, de-emphasizing the garage door and making the street presentation of the house kinder to the neighborhood.
The house is akin to a custom, modern-day Eichler home in many ways. Inspired by mid-century modern homes with today’s materials, approaches, standards, and technologies. The goals were to create an indoor-outdoor home that was energy-efficient, light and flexible for young children to grow. This 3,000 square foot, 3 bedroom, 2.5 bathroom new house is located in Los Altos in the heart of the Silicon Valley.

When full-time Massachusetts residents contemplate building a second home in Telluride, Colorado the question immediately arises; does it make most sense to hire a regionally based Rocky Mountain architect or a sea level architect conveniently located for all of the rigorous collaboration required for successful bespoke home design. Determined to prove the latter true, Siemasko + Verbridge accompanied the potential client as they scoured the undulating Telluride landscape in search of the perfect house site.
The selected site’s harmonious balance of untouched meadow rising up to meet the edge of an aspen grove and the opposing 180 degree view of Wilson’s Range spoke to everyone. A plateau just beyond a fork in the meadow provided a natural flatland, requiring little excavation and yet the right amount of upland slope to capture the views. The intrinsic character of the site was only enriched by an elk trail and snake-rail fence.
Establishing the expanse of Wilson’s range would be best served by rejecting the notion of selected views, the central sweeping curve of the roof inverts a small saddle in the range with which it is perfectly aligned. The soaring wave of custom windows and the open floor plan make the relatively modest house feel sizable despite its footprint of just under 2,000 square feet. Officially a two bedroom home, the bunk room and loft allow the home to comfortably sleep ten, encouraging large gatherings of family and friends. The home is completely off the grid in response to the unique and fragile qualities of the landscape. Great care was taken to respect the regions vernacular through the use of mostly native materials and a palette derived from the terrain found at 9,820 feet above sea level.

The Mazama house is located in the Methow Valley of Washington State, a secluded mountain valley on the eastern edge of the North Cascades, about 200 miles northeast of Seattle.
The house has been carefully placed in a copse of trees at the easterly end of a large meadow. Two major building volumes indicate the house organization. A grounded 2-story bedroom wing anchors a raised living pavilion that is lifted off the ground by a series of exposed steel columns. Seen from the access road, the large meadow in front of the house continues right under the main living space, making the living pavilion into a kind of bridge structure spanning over the meadow grass, with the house touching the ground lightly on six steel columns. The raised floor level provides enhanced views as well as keeping the main living level well above the 3-4 feet of winter snow accumulation that is typical for the upper Methow Valley.
To further emphasize the idea of lightness, the exposed wood structure of the living pavilion roof changes pitch along its length, so the roof warps upward at each end. The interior exposed wood beams appear like an unfolding fan as the roof pitch changes. The main interior bearing columns are steel with a tapered “V”-shape, recalling the lightness of a dancer.
The house reflects the continuing FINNE investigation into the idea of crafted modernism, with cast bronze inserts at the front door, variegated laser-cut steel railing panels, a curvilinear cast-glass kitchen counter, waterjet-cut aluminum light fixtures, and many custom furniture pieces. The house interior has been designed to be completely integral with the exterior. The living pavilion contains more than twelve pieces of custom furniture and lighting, creating a totality of the designed environment that recalls the idea of Gesamtkunstverk, as seen in the work of Josef Hoffman and the Viennese Secessionist movement in the early 20th century.
The house has been designed from the start as a sustainable structure, with 40% higher insulation values than required by code, radiant concrete slab heating, efficient natural ventilation, large amounts of natural lighting, water-conserving plumbing fixtures, and locally sourced materials. Windows have high-performance LowE insulated glazing and are equipped with concealed shades. A radiant hydronic heat system with exposed concrete floors allows lower operating temperatures and higher occupant comfort levels. The concrete slabs conserve heat and provide great warmth and comfort for the feet.
Deep roof overhangs, built-in shades and high operating clerestory windows are used to reduce heat gain in summer months. During the winter, the lower sun angle is able to penetrate into living spaces and passively warm the exposed concrete floor. Low VOC paints and stains have been used throughout the house. The high level of craft evident in the house reflects another key principle of sustainable design: build it well and make it last for many years!

These clients came to my office looking for an architect who could design their "empty nest" home that would be the focus of their soon to be extended family. A place where the kids and grand kids would want to hang out: with a pool, open family room/ kitchen, garden; but also one-story so there wouldn't be any unnecessary stairs to climb. They wanted the design to feel like "old Pasadena" with the coziness and attention to detail that the era embraced. My sensibilities led me to recall the wonderful classic mansions of San Marino, so I designed a manor house clad in trim Bluestone with a steep French slate roof and clean white entry, eave and dormer moldings that would blend organically with the future hardscape plan and thoughtfully landscaped grounds.
The site was a deep, flat lot that had been half of the old Joan Crawford estate; the part that had an abandoned swimming pool and small cabana. I envisioned a pavilion filled with natural light set in a beautifully planted park with garden views from all sides. Having a one-story house allowed for tall and interesting shaped ceilings that carved into the sheer angles of the roof. The most private area of the house would be the central loggia with skylights ensconced in a deep woodwork lattice grid and would be reminiscent of the outdoor “Salas” found in early Californian homes. The family would soon gather there and enjoy warm afternoons and the wonderfully cool evening hours together.
Working with interior designer Jeffrey Hitchcock, we designed an open family room/kitchen with high dark wood beamed ceilings, dormer windows for daylight, custom raised panel cabinetry, granite counters and a textured glass tile splash. Natural light and gentle breezes flow through the many French doors and windows located to accommodate not only the garden views, but the prevailing sun and wind as well. The graceful living room features a dramatic vaulted white painted wood ceiling and grand fireplace flanked by generous double hung French windows and elegant drapery. A deeply cased opening draws one into the wainscot paneled dining room that is highlighted by hand painted scenic wallpaper and a barrel vaulted ceiling. The walnut paneled library opens up to reveal the waterfall feature in the back garden. Equally picturesque and restful is the view from the rotunda in the master bedroom suite.
